Preliminary Information
When diagnosing this powertrain, you will almost certainly need to use the diagnostic procedures in this or other powertrain systems. The diagnostic procedures are mostly in the form of tables. At the beginning (formerly known as the Facing Page) of each DTC is a circuit diagram, descriptions, and notes about the condition or the DTC diagnosed in the table. Reading the diagnostic support information helps you to understand the system being tested, the components involved in the testing, how the
PCM tests the system, how the PCM determines that the diagnostic has failed, and what the table is trying to accomplish. Below are explanations of the diagnostic support information and the tables for DTCs.
